What is the Medical Treatment Visa (Subclass 602)?

The Medical Treatment Visa (subclass 602) is a temporary visa designed for:

  • Individuals seeking medical treatment or consultations unavailable or urgent in their home country.
  • Organ donors traveling to Australia.
  • Family members or supporters accompanying or joining a visa holder for treatment or donation.

This visa replaced older subclasses like 675 and 685, consolidating options into one streamlined category. It allows single or multiple entries, depending on your circumstances, and permits short-term study (up to 3 months).

Unlike visitor visas, the subclass 602 accommodates applicants who might not meet standard health requirements for other visas, provided they arrange private treatment and cover all costs.

Eligibility and 602 Visa Requirements

To qualify for the 602 visa, you must meet key criteria set by the Department of Home Affairs. Here's a breakdown:

Requirement Category Details
Medical Purpose Evidence of arranged treatment, consultation, or organ donation in Australia (e.g., letter from Australian doctor or hospital).
Genuine Intention Must prove the visit is solely for medical reasons and that you will depart Australia after treatment.
Financial Capacity Sufficient funds to cover treatment, living costs, and travel, or evidence of sponsorship.
Health Insurance Adequate private health insurance strongly recommended to cover hospital and medical expenses.
Health & Character Meet character requirements; health exams may be required, but waivers possible for the treated condition.
Support Role Supporters must prove relationship and necessity (e.g., family member or carer).
Age & Nationality Open to all ages and nationalities; no points test required.

 

Key 602 visa requirements include submitting Form 1507 (Evidence of Intended Medical Treatment) signed by a registered practitioner for certain applications. You cannot have unpaid debts to the Australian government or outstanding public health costs.

As of 2025, no major changes have affected eligibility, but always check the official ImmiAccount portal for updates.

How to Apply for the 602 Visa Application

The 602 visa application process is straightforward and primarily online:

  1. Gather Documents: Passport, medical letters, financial proof, health insurance, and Form 48ME if health exams are needed.
  2. Create ImmiAccount: Apply via the Department of Home Affairs website.
  3. Lodge Application: Online (preferred) or paper form (Form 48R) if outside Australia.
  4. Pay Fees: If applicable.
  5. Biometrics & Health Checks: Provide if requested.
  6. Wait for Decision: Track via ImmiAccount.

Applications can be lodged inside or outside Australia. For urgent cases, priority processing may be available with strong evidence.

Required supporting documents often include:

  • Passport copy
  • Medical correspondence detailing diagnosis, treatment plan, and duration
  • Proof of funds (bank statements or sponsor letter)
  • Overseas health insurance policy

Medical Visa Fee and Costs

The medical visa fee for subclass 602 varies by location:

Applicant Location Base Visa Application Charge (2025) Notes
Outside Australia Free Standard for most offshore applicants.
Inside Australia AUD 380 Applies to onshore extensions or new applications.
Foreign Government Representatives Free Full exemption applies.
Additional Applicants (Family) Included No extra base fee; other charges may apply.

 

Additional costs include health examinations (AUD 300–500), biometrics (AUD 50–100), and private health insurance (varies by coverage). Treatment costs are fully borne by the applicant—no access to Medicare unless reciprocal arrangements apply.

Processing Times for Subclass 602 Visa

Processing times for the medical treatment visa vary based on completeness and urgency. As of late 2025, indicative times (from secondary migration sources and historical data) are:

Percentage of Applications Processing Time
25% 5–7 days
50% 8–20 days
75% 1–2 months
90% 3–4 months

 

Urgent medical cases with compelling evidence (e.g., life-threatening conditions) can be processed faster. Use the official Visa Processing Time Guide Tool for the latest estimates.

Benefits and Stay Duration

The 602 visa allows stays tailored to your treatment plan—typically up to 12 months. Multiple-entry visas enable return trips for follow-ups.

Benefits include:

  • Access to Australia's advanced medical facilities
  • Ability to bring support persons
  • Short-term study permission
  • No work rights (except very limited cases)

You must depart before expiry; extensions require a new application.

FAQS

Q: What is the Medical Treatment Visa (Subclass 602)?

It's a temporary visa for medical treatment, consultations, organ donation, or support in Australia.

Q: How much is the medical visa fee for subclass 602?

Free if applied outside Australia; AUD 380 if inside. Exemptions apply for certain cases.

Q: What are the main 602 visa requirements?

Medical evidence, financial proof, health insurance, and genuine temporary intent.

Q: How long does 602 visa processing take in 2025?

Typically 8 days to 3 months, depending on application completeness and urgency.

Q: Can I extend my subclass 602 visa?

No direct extensions; apply for a new visa if more time is needed.

Q: Can family members apply with me on the 602 visa application?

Yes, as supporters, with evidence of necessity.

Q: Do I need health insurance for the medical visa Australia?

Strongly recommended and often required to cover all treatment costs.
